HUBTEX introduced its new SQ 40 compact reach truck

hubtex SQ 40 compact reach truck

Capacities up to 4000 kg and aisle width equal to standard reach trucks
Photo by HUBTEX Maschinenbau GmbH & Co. KG

New flagship model – the SQ 40 in the reach truck core segment of the HUBTEX product range. This is how the company presented a new series at CeMAT: the SQ 40 with a basic load bearing capacity of 4 t with a 600 mm centre of gravity. It achieves considerably higher load bearing capacities than conventional reach trucks but with the same working aisle widths.

The requirements for development of the new Hubtex reach truck were customer and market-specific. The machinery and tools to be transported are becoming more and more challenging with regard to the centre of gravity, which has pushed previous reach trucks to their limits. Hubtex therefore began developing the SQ 40 around six months ago. The objective, which has now been accomplished, was to achieve high load bearing capacities in combination with high centres of gravity while maintaining extremely compact dimensions. This convinced a tyre manufacturer, for example, which has its reach truck positioned relatively far away from the point where the tools – in this case, metal grids for creating tyre profiles – are used.

During development of the truck, Hubtex performed a difficult balancing act: the company included individual special applications, but also ensured that a broad range of applications – heavy-duty operations in material and tool handling within a confined space – were covered by the SQ 40.
